29.740 Contracts for walleye production.

29.740(1) (1) In this section, "local governmental unit" means a city, village, town, or county.

29.740(2) (2) The department may enter into contracts with local governmental units, federally recognized Indian tribes or bands located in this state, and fish farms for the purpose of increasing the amount of walleye available for stocking in the waters of the state.

29.740(3) (3) The terms of a contract entered into under this section may include all of the following:

29.740(3)(a) (a) Authorization for the department to furnish fish eggs and fish for free or at cost to a local governmental unit, tribe, band, or fish farm that is a party to the contract.

29.740(3)(b) (b) Authorization for the department to purchase fish from a local governmental unit, tribe, band, or fish farm that is a party to the contract.

29.740(4) (4) No contract entered into under this section may have a term that is more than 5 years.

History: 2013 a. 20.
